Paco de lucia-solea

paco de lucia solea

Soleá, soleares is one of the most basic forms or "palos" of Flamenco music, probably originating around Cádiz or Seville in Andalusia, the most southern region of Spain. It is normally accompanied by one guitar only, in the key of E phrygian, although it is also heard in A phrygian, relatively often. (wikipedia)

Stochelo Rosenberg guitar lesson #2

stochelo rosenberg guitar lesson

Stochelo Rosenberg was born in a gypsy camp in Helmond, on Februari 19th, 1968. He has 4 brothers and 1 sister and was the first son of Mimer Rosenberg and Metz Grunholz. He started playing guitar at age 10, taught by his father and his uncle Wasso Grunholz, but most he learned from listening to his hero Django Reinhardt. At age 12, Stochelo won the first price on a tv concours, toghether with his nephew Nous'che Rosenberg (rhythm guitar) and Rino van Hooydonk (bassguitar).

Use of microtones in the vocals of Robert Johnson

sonic arts A Microtonal Analysis of Robert Johnson's

"To a great extent, the powerful emotional mood in Johnson's songs is a result of his masterful manipulation of microtonal intervals in his singing, and in Hellhound, in much of the guitar part. His voice could sound like a moan, whisper, yell, or trombone solo, with seemingly effortless ease — unless he constricted his throat for an even stronger effect — and the slide guitar parts could evoke the same. In a couple of songs, he sings about the wind howling, then the driving guitar rhythm suddenly stops for a moment, while Johnson slides up to a single note that can raise the hair on the back of your neck."

Article from 1998 by Joe Monzo

The C-A-G-E-D System

The C-A-G-E-D System

This system was first codified by Bill Edwards in the series of books entitled Fretboard Logic. The series goes into incredible detail, but the concept behind it is actually quite simple. Essentially, it breaks the guitar's fretboard down into five fingerings that are very easy and most likely very familiar to you already. These are the standard, open-position major chords that every guitar player knows, C A G E and D
